Full Job Description
Job Description

Job Description

Participates in the planning, organizing and coordinating matters pertaining to the security and safety of the health system's entities, people, and property. Conducts and collaborates with confidential and sensitive investigations, including field surveillance, and collection and cataloging of evidence. Provides executive protection and transportation, as needed; participates in security training functions, as necessary.

Job Responsibility

  • Conducts internal and external investigations for fraud or criminal activity against the company resulting in loss of assets, records or property.
  • Investigates and addresses threats made against employees, patients and visitors.
  • Investigations may include, but are not limited to Medicare fraud, financial crimes, internal thefts, identity theft, drug diversions, prescription fraud, or crimes against employees or organization guests.
  • Performs surveillance of sites and suspects to obtain evidences, establish probable cause or link multiple suspects to probable fraud or criminal activity.
  • Collaborates with local law enforcement on investigations.
  • Collects and catalogs physical evidence maintaining chain of custody, when applicable; testifies in court, if necessary.
  • Participates in the coordination of overall security and protection to people, facilities, and property in the organization.
  • Performs field surveillance and assists with maintenance of security systems.
  • Protects and transports Senior Leadership, as needed; may be called to assist in handling any organization emergency.
  • Participates in security training functions, as necessary; carries a firearm, as directed.
  • Performs related duties as required. All responsibilities noted here are considered essential functions of the job under the Americans with Disabilities Act. Duties not mentioned here, but considered related are not essential functions.


Job Qualification

  • Associate's Degree required, or equivalent combination of education and related experience.
  • Valid Pistol Permit in New York State required, plus specialized certifications as needed.
  • 3-5 years of relevant experience, required.

About Northwell Health

Northwell Health is a non-profit healthcare organization that provides clinical care, research, and medical education in New York. It is the largest healthcare provider and private employer in the state of New York, with over 72000 employees. Northwell Health has 23 hospitals and more than 700 outpatient facilities, as well as a medical school and a research institute. The organization was founded in 1997 as North Shore-Long Island Jewish Health System and changed its name to Northwell Health in 2015.
